Back up Camera...Anyone installed one?
I recently installed a new Kenwood 7120 in my Ford Escape Hybrid. I am looking to do the same in the 07 Z06. It features an input for a back up camera. If any car needed a view to the rear it is a C6 Corvette!
I would like to find the most stealth camera I can find. Anyone mount one to their C6 yet? If so, any pictures? What brand do you recommend?
I'd like to get all the components together before the install so I only have to go in once!

Camera
Sonicelectronix http://www.sonicelectronix.com/onix makes a goodlooking camera made into th liecense frame rl26, only problem is it is not too dependable, this will be the 3rd one I will install.
But I think another company makes one.

I've got an Avic Z1 with a bypass installed so everything works while you are in motion. I am having the body shop that is repainting my car put the rear camera in the front bumper so I can pop it on when parking to make sure I don't hit something, and will also be figuring out how to hook it to a camcorder for mountain runs and track events.
